Abstract | The invention relates to a method to increase production of itaconic acid in a micro-organism by inhibiting the expression or functioning of the enzyme itaconyl-CoA transferase, itaconyl-CoA hydratase (citramalyl-CoA hydrolyase; EC 4.2.1.56) and/or citramalyl-CoA lyase. Also embodied are micro-organisms, preferably Aspergillus s terreus or Aspergillus niger, in which said enzyme is inhibited. |
